CP Holidays arrives with catalogue
All product in wholesaler CP Holidays’ first TakeOff Asia catalogue carries 12% commission, except for Royal Caribbean Cruise Lines cruises at 10%.
The catalogue carries RCCL’ Singapore-Hong Kong and Shanghai-Shanghai cruises, CP Holidays packages and accommodation in Vietnam, Japan, China, Thailand, Borneo, Macau, Malaysia and Singapore as well as Cathay Pacific Holidays product in Hong Kong.
It is the first printed product presented by Orient Express Travel Group’s new wholesale division and marks the entry of CP Holidays as a wholesaler.
The 8-page catalogue was created specifically for OETG’s Select Travel network, which now has 180 member agents around Australia.
OETG Product Development Manager, Denise Dodd said the catalogue was the next step in the Select brand taking a more prominent position in the consumer market.
“With this catalogue, Select agents now have collateral for consumers which carry great fares and exceptional rates,” she said. “Our commitment to Select agents is also represented by our commissions.”
The catalogue promotes an introductory 15% discount on travel insurance for bookings and deposits made with Select Travel.
A featured product is the 10-day personalised China Experience package priced from $1,845 per person twin share, land only. This tour includes Shanghai, Xian and Beijing.
Almost all listed hotels are 4 or 5 star.
As a diversified travel company, Orient Express Travel Group is also a consolidator (Express Ticketing and Express Fares for The Select Travel Group and other travel agent networks), a retailer (AST student travel brand) and a corporate travel management company (Orient Express Travel Corporate, which includes MICE services).
